Key legal considerations
Several critical legal elements must be carefully addressed in your Joint Venture Investment Agreement. Capital contribution structures should clearly define initial and ongoing financial commitments, including timing, currency, and conditions for additional funding rounds. Shareholding arrangements must specify ownership percentages, voting rights, and any special rights attached to different share classes. Management and control provisions should establish board composition, decision-making processes, and day-to-day operational responsibilities. Intellectual property clauses need to address ownership, licensing, and protection of existing and newly developed IP. Exit mechanisms should include detailed procedures for voluntary withdrawal, forced exit scenarios, valuation methods, and dispute resolution processes. Risk allocation provisions must clearly define each party's liability, indemnification obligations, and insurance requirements.
Legal requirements in Singapore
Singapore law imposes specific requirements that must be incorporated into your Joint Venture Investment Agreement. Under the Companies Act, the venture structure must comply with corporate governance standards, including proper director appointments, shareholder meetings, and record-keeping obligations. The Securities and Futures Act applies if the venture involves securities issuance or trading activities, requiring appropriate regulatory disclosures and compliance measures. Competition Act considerations ensure the joint venture structure doesn't create anti-competitive arrangements or market dominance issues. Foreign investment regulations may apply depending on the parties' nationalities and the business sector involved. Tax structuring must consider Singapore's territorial tax system, double taxation agreements, and any applicable incentive schemes. The agreement should also address regulatory approvals required for specific industries and ensure compliance with anti-money laundering and know-your-customer requirements.
